Die Verzerrung



Example: Die Verzerrung in den Daten beeinflusst das Forschungsergebnis.

Definition


"Die Verzerrung" refers to the distortion or bias in data or research results, which affects the accuracy and validity of scientific findings. It represents an alteration that skews the true representation of information, leading to misleading conclusions.

Etymology


The word "die Verzerrung" comes from the German verb "verzerren," meaning to distort or warp. It is formed by the prefix 'ver-' indicating a change or transformation, combined with 'zerren,' meaning to pull or tug. Did you know? The term originally conveyed the idea of physically twisting or pulling something out of shape, now metaphorically applied to data or perceptions.
